Always wanted to go Turbo and finally pulling the trigger. I have a 402 LS2 Base motor. 10.5 comp. Running a 239/247 113 cam. I have every bolt on already and made 502 rwhp. I'm wanting to reach 750 at the rear wheels. I'm thinking of s475 WB turbo. T6 1.32 ar. Could I reach my goals with this and how easy. I don't have E85 at that many places in Baton Rouge so just intercooler. I'm not wanting to go ***** to the wall.

I ran 10.7 at the track on motor before getting kicked off, I'm looking just to make it 9.8 or so. Please chime in and tell me what to do. I do understand a 80mm or bigger would be better but I'm only looking for 750 or so. I dont want to change cams either. So I'm thinking the s475 will give a good spool time and put me at my 750 range on pump gas. This is my first turbo build so I'm learning all the little details. Below will be my complete setup. Tell me what is the best option if I try to run a s475. Space is very limited.


LS2 Alum block / 402 ci
LS6 Stage 2.5 heads
239/247 113 cam 600 lift ( I think )
Fast 102
46 lbs Fast Injectors
Twin Walbro 255 fuel pumps with return system
Callie compstar Crank
Callies Rods
-10cc Malhe Pistons
Ported oil pump
M6 t56

PLans for S475 non race housing
Lq9 Manifolds
2.5 hotside to T6 flange
3" cold side
4" intercooler
50mm Wastegate and BOV

You may want to back off on the compression a little to be on the safe side. Also those injectors need to go and if I were you I wouldnt run the fast intake. Seen a few crack with turbo motors. As far as a turbo a billet wheel s480 from Forced Inductions would be a nice street friendly turbo for you...

I think you need to rethink your combo again
that is large motor for s475 and you top it off with 17 degrees of overlap cam.
